The Late Show is going on its summer break on Thursday, June 26, with a rerun airing on CBS. Here’s what you need to know.
The Late Show with Stephen Colbert is on its summer hiatus, with no new episodes from June 26 to July 11. Reruns of the late night talk show will air every week night on CBS at 11:35 pm ET/PT.
